WebAug 13, 2024 · Remember, the deadline for filing will be: First Quarter: May 15 Second Quarter: August 15 Third Quarter: November 15. For the 4thquarter, this will be included in the Annual filing of the ITR, which is due for next year. I hope this post was able to help you. WebApr 19, 2024 · Form 1701Q 1st Quarter – On or before May 15 of the current taxable year. 2nd Quarter – On or before August 15 of the current taxable year. 3rd Quarter – On or before November 15 of the current taxable year. Form 1702-EX Filed on or before the 15th day of the 4th month following the close of the taxpayer’s taxable year.
